Potential Healthcare Cost Increases for Teledyne Technologies in 2026 As healthcare costs continue to escalate, Teledyne Technologies employees and retirees may bristle under the weight of anticipated premium hikes in 2026. With the potential expiration of federal premium subsidies from the Affordable Care Act (ACA), some enrollees could see monthly premiums soar by over 75%. This dramatic uptick is compounded by an industry-wide trend of rising medical costs and significant rate increases from large insurers. Employees must strategically prepare for these potential disruptions by reviewing their healthcare plans and opting for services ahead of time, to mitigate the financial burden in the event of steep pricing changes. Balancing Social Security with Part-Time Work
Many find that retiring doesn't necessarily mean completely ending their professional life. For Teledyne Technologies employees, engaging in part-time work can serve as a bridge from full-time work to full retirement, supplementing income while easing into a new lifestyle. Importantly, this arrangement doesn't jeopardize Social Security benefits. For those earning less than $22,320 annually through part-time work, Social Security retirement benefits remain unaffected, making this a viable option.

What type of 401(k) plan does Teledyne Technologies offer?
Teledyne Technologies offers a traditional 401(k) plan that allows employees to save for retirement on a tax-deferred basis.
How can employees of Teledyne Technologies enroll in the 401(k) plan?
Employees can enroll in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an through the company’s HR portal during the open enrollment period or upon their eligibility date.
What is the employer match for the 401(k) plan at Teledyne Technologies?
Teledyne Technologies provides a matching contribution up to a certain percentage of the employee's salary, which is detailed in the plan summary.
Are there any eligibility requirements to participate in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an?
Yes, employees must meet certain eligibility criteria, such as age and length of service, to participate in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an.
Can employees of Teledyne Technologies change their contribution percentage?
Yes, employees can change their contribution percentage at any time through the HR portal or by contacting the benefits department at Teledyne Technologies.
What investment options are available in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an?
The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an offers a variety of investment options, including mutual funds, target-date funds, and company stock.
Does Teledyne Technologies allow for loans against the 401(k) plan?
Yes, Teledyne Technologies allows employees to take loans against their 401(k) balance, subject to certain terms and conditions outlined in the plan.
What happens to my 401(k) account if I leave Teledyne Technologies?
If you leave Teledyne Technologies, you can either roll over your 401(k) balance to another qualified plan, cash out, or leave it in the Teledyne Technologies plan if you meet the minimum balance requirement.
How often can employees contribute to the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an?
Employees can contribute to the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an through payroll deductions, which occur with each paycheck.
Is there a vesting schedule for the employer match in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an?
Yes, there is a vesting schedule for the employer match in the Teledyne Technologies 401(k) plan, which determines when employees fully own the employer contributions.
